Transaction 2844feecf0124092eb806da863fa5c7767145b0560e7525c5c42fe3c878be0b7
1 Input
2 Outputs
- 2844feecf0124092eb806da863fa5c7767145b0560e7525c5c42fe3c878be0b7:0
- 2844feecf0124092eb806da863fa5c7767145b0560e7525c5c42fe3c878be0b7:1
value 2056295
address 12k9hXKYwCpZ48ZjyxaonqfkZBf7aUpaZD
value 4404322
address 1MQbzR5oKT7A6SW3TKPWWuXeERN6MujzsQ